What Is A Buffer Board?

A buffer board in a plasma TV is a circuit board that plays a critical role in video processing. This electronic component is responsible for communicating between the television’s main circuit board and the display panel. Its primary function is to convert and stabilize the video signals, ensuring that images are displayed clearly and without distortion.

How Do Buffer Boards Work?

The operation of a buffer board is integral to the functioning of a plasma TV. Here’s how it performs its essential tasks:

  1. Signal Processing: The buffer board receives raw video signals from the main board. It processes these signals to ensure they are suitable for the plasma panel, adjusting aspects like resolution, brightness, and color levels.

  2. Communication: It acts as a mediator, allowing the main board and the display panel to communicate effectively. This helps synchronize the images displayed on the screen, enabling smooth motion during fast-action scenes.

  3. Image Stabilization: One of the significant responsibilities of the buffer board is to stabilize the image. By mitigating any potential flickering or distortion, the buffer board enhances the viewing experience, ensuring images are not just vivid but also consistent.

Components of a Buffer Board

A buffer board comprises several essential components that work in harmony:

  • Transistors: These are used to amplify the video signals and facilitate accurate processing.
  • Capacitors: They help filter out noise from the signals to ensure a clear output.
  • Connectors: These link the buffer board to both the main board and the plasma panel, allowing for signal transmission.

Signs Of A Malfunctioning Buffer Board

Recognizing the signs of a malfunctioning buffer board can help you address issues before they escalate into more significant problems. Here are indications you should watch for:

  • Frequent flickering or blank screens.
  • Color distortion or incorrect image displays.

If you experience any of these symptoms, consider having a professional technician inspect your television.

Buffer Board Vs. Other Circuit Boards In Plasma TVs

Buffer boards are just one type of circuit board found in plasma TVs. Understanding their differences and functions compared to other boards can help clarify their unique roles:

Main Board

The main board is the central hub of the television, containing the processor and handling the overall operation of the TV. Unlike the buffer board, the main board is responsible for control functions, input handling, and audio processing.

T-Con Board

The T-Con (Timing Control) board works in tandem with the buffer board and is responsible for properly timing the signals sent to the display panel. It ensures synchronization of image execution but does not handle the video signals.

Power Supply Board

The power supply board provides the necessary voltage and current to all components of the television, including the buffer board. A malfunction in the power supply can affect the operation of various boards, making it essential for overall functionality.

Common Issues With Buffer Boards

Despite their robustness, buffer boards can run into issues over time. Here are some common problems you might encounter:

Electrical Failure

Electrical issues such as short circuits or connections can lead to buffer board failure. This could manifest in numerous ways, including image distortion or complete failure to display.

Overheating

Excessive heat can damage the components of a buffer board. This can occur due to poor ventilation or excessive usage over extended periods, which results in decreased performance or board failure.

Replacing A Buffer Board: A Step-by-Step Guide

If you decide to replace the buffer board in your plasma TV, here’s a simplified step-by-step guide. However, it is important to note that unless you are experienced with electronics, it may be best to hire a professional.

Tools You May Need

  • Screwdrivers (Phillips and flat-head)
  • Antistatic wrist strap
  • Replacement buffer board
  • Pliers

Steps For Replacement

  1. Unplug the TV: Disconnect the TV from the power source to ensure safety.
  2. Remove the Back Cover: Using a screwdriver, remove the screws holding the back cover in place and gently lift it off.
  3. Locate the Buffer Board: Identify the buffer board, which is typically near the display panel and connected with multiple cables.
  4. Disconnect Cables: Carefully unplug the connectors from the buffer board to prepare for removal.
  5. Unscrew the Buffer Board: Remove any screws securing the buffer board to the TV chassis.
  6. Install the New Board: Position the new buffer board where the old one was situated and secure it with screws.
  7. Reconnect Cables: Plug in the connectors to the new board.
  8. Replace the Back Cover: Once everything is secured and connected properly, replace the back cover.
  9. Plug In and Test: Finally, plug the TV back into the power source and turn it on to test the new installation.

How Can I Tell If My Buffer Board Is Failing?

Signs of a failing buffer board can manifest in various ways, with the most noticeable being abnormalities in the picture displayed on the screen. You might encounter issues like lines appearing vertically or horizontally across the screen, color distortions, or flickering images. These symptoms indicate that the buffer board may not be processing the video signals correctly, leading to poor display quality.

In some cases, you might also experience complete screen blackouts, which can be confusing as the TV may still be operational from an audio perspective. To further diagnose a potential buffer board failure, it’s advisable to perform a thorough check on other components of the television, ensuring they are functioning correctly. If other elements are intact and the visual issues persist, the buffer board is likely the culprit.

What Should I Look For When Purchasing A Buffer Board?

When looking to purchase a buffer board, it’s essential to ensure compatibility with your specific plasma TV model. Always check the part number on your old board, as different models might have variations even among similar brands. Purchasing the correct board not only guarantees proper function but also helps avoid additional electrical issues that might arise from using incompatible parts.

Additionally, consider buying from reputable dealers or manufacturers that provide warranties or return policies. This way, if the buffer board does not solve your issue or does not fit correctly, you have the option to return it without incurring significant losses. Reviews and ratings from other customers can also be helpful in determining the quality of the part you are considering.

How Much Does It Cost To Replace A Buffer Board?

The cost of replacing a buffer board can vary significantly based on a few factors, including the brand and model of the plasma TV, as well as the source from which you purchase the part. Typically, you can expect prices to range from $50 to $200 for the component itself. If you decide to hire a repair technician to perform the installation, labor costs can add an additional $100 to $150, depending on regional service rates and the complexity of the job.

If you’re considering a DIY approach to save on labor, take into account the tools you might need for the job, which could also influence the overall cost. While it may seem like a more economical option to replace the buffer board yourself, always weigh the risks of potential errors against the potential savings. In some cases, if the oil expenses of repair approach the cost of a new television, it might be worth considering an upgrade instead.

Are There Alternatives To Replacing The Buffer Board?

While replacing the buffer board is a common solution for issues related to display quality, there are alternative paths you can take. One option is to engage in troubleshooting to see if the problem lies elsewhere, such as in the main board, power supply, or connections. Sometimes, loose connections or software issues can mimic buffer board failure. A reset or software update might resolve the issue without needing to replace any hardware.

Another alternative is to explore professional repair services that offer diagnostics and repairs for plasma TVs. These services can often identify the root cause of the problem and may provide options beyond replacing the buffer board, such as repairing it if feasible. Additionally, as technology evolves, servicing older plasma TVs might become costly, leading some consumers to weigh the possibility of upgrading to a newer model altogether, which might provide better picture quality and additional features.
